The Rise of Urgent Care in Modern Healthcare

Urgent care clinics have become popular recently, filling a critical healthcare gap between primary care providers and emergency rooms. 

Primary care offices are not always equipped to handle same-day appointments or after-hours needs. In contrast, emergency rooms focus on life-threatening injuries and illnesses and often have long wait times. Urgent care fills this void by providing walk-in appointments and after-hours care for non-life-threatening conditions that still require timely treatment. The accessibility and convenience of urgent care make it an appealing option for many common illnesses and injuries.

 

Deciding When To Visit Urgent Care

 

1. Non-life-threatening situations

Knowing when to visit urgent care is essential, especially in non-life-threatening situations. Minor illnesses such as colds or flu, urinary tract infections or sexually transmitted diseases (STDs), and common injuries like minor cuts and bruises can be effectively treated at urgent care centers. These facilities are equipped to tackle a wide range of medical issues promptly, providing a quicker alternative to scheduling an appointment with a primary care physician.

 

2. After-hours primary care needs

When primary care offices are closed, and waiting until the next business day is not an option, urgent care becomes a convenient choice. Urgent care centers operate during extended hours to cater to after-hours primary care needs, whether a sudden cold, persistent cough, or other acute but non-emergency conditions.

In cases of minor injuries and ailments such as sprains, minor burns, or allergies, urgent care is an excellent option. These centers offer immediate attention and care without the prolonged wait times often associated with emergency rooms. Unlike emergency rooms with long wait times, urgent care ensures a quicker resolution and relief for the patient.

4. Routine medical services 

Urgent care goes beyond just helping with urgent issues; it also covers routine medical services. Whether you need regular check-ups, vaccinations, or other preventive care, urgent care centers have you covered. This flexibility makes urgent care a convenient choice for various healthcare needs.

 

Benefits of Visiting Urgent Care

Faster service: In considering when to visit urgent care, remember that quick service is one of its primary benefits. Patients can easily walk in without an appointment and receive timely medical attention. This speed is beneficial if you have minor illnesses or injuries and need care immediately. 

Cost-effective: Visiting urgent care is often more cost-effective than going to an emergency room for non-life-threatening situations. With lower copays and fees, urgent care provides an affordable alternative without compromising the quality of care.

Accessibility and convenience: Urgent care centers are conveniently placed in communities for easy access. With extended hours, including evenings and weekends, patients can get medical help without interrupting their daily schedule. This accessibility and convenience make urgent care a practical and user-friendly choice for many people.

Comprehensive care: Urgent care centers offer comprehensive care beyond treating acute illnesses and injuries. They provide various services, including diagnostic tests, sick visits, and sports physicals. This holistic approach contributes to the overall well-being of patients.

Knowing the Limitations: When NOT to Visit Urgent Care

Urgent care is a valuable resource but is not always the go-to for every situation. Life-threatening emergencies, such as heart attacks or severe injuries, require immediate attention at an emergency room or by calling 911. Urgent care is not equipped for these critical situations.

Moreover, individuals with long-term chronic conditions are better served by a primary physician who can provide ongoing and specialized care. So, be aware of when to visit urgent care and when to visit others, like the ER or primary care physician.
